Mr. John Oiveira, a dairy farmer near San Leandro, California. His parents were born in Portugal but he and his son, Mr. A.J. Oliveira, who is cashier of First National Bank of San Leandro, were born in the United States. The Portuguese people have become important in the dairying business throughout the entire state of California and now control at least seventy percent of the dairy business of the state. Mr. Oliveira milks about seventy cows daily. "Our favorite stories when I was a child were those which my father and mother told us about their homeland of Portugal. My wife and I have had a good life in the U.S. and we are proud to see our son an honored man of the community. All of us, we are as American as fried chicken now."
